teradata数据迁移到 oracle (解决方法与步骤)

下面内容仅为某些场景参考,为稳妥起见请先联系上面的专业技术工程师,具体环境具体分析。

2023-11-08 12:40 55

Teradata是一种用于大数据分析的强大数据库平台,而Oracle是一种功能强大的关系型数据库管理系统。在某些情况下,企业需要将其现有的Teradata数据迁移到Oracle中。本文将讨论Teradata数据迁移到Oracle的适用场景、原因、解决方案、处理流程、技术人员要求、注意事项、容易出错的地方以及相关FAQ。

适用场景: - 当企业从Teradata平台转向Oracle数据库时,需要将现有的Teradata数据迁移到Oracle中。 - 当企业决定以Oracle作为新的数据分析和查询平台时,需要将现有的Teradata数据迁移到Oracle中。

举例说明: 一个跨国零售公司决定将其数据仓库从Teradata迁移到Oracle数据库中。他们在Teradata中存储了大量的销售数据、客户数据和库存数据。为了在Oracle平台上继续进行数据分析和报告,他们需要将这些数据迁移到Oracle中。

teradata数据迁移到 oracle2

相关原因: - Oracle数据库在可扩展性、性能和稳定性方面具有优势。 - 向Oracle迁移可以节省运维成本和硬件成本。 - 企业决策层更熟悉Oracle数据库,因此更容易进行数据查询和分析。

解决方案: - 数据迁移工具:可以使用Oracle提供的数据迁移工具,例如Oracle Data Pump和Oracle GoldenGate,进行数据迁移。 - ETL工具:使用ETL(Extract, Transform, Load)工具,如Informatica、DataStage等,进行数据从Teradata到Oracle的转换和加载。

处理流程: 1. 评估数据量和复杂性:了解Teradata数据库中的数据量、表结构和复杂性,以便制定合适的迁移计划。 2. 数据清洗和转换:根据Oracle的数据模型要求,对Teradata数据进行清洗和转换,包括处理数据类型、日期格式等。 3. 迁移数据:使用数据迁移工具或ETL工具,将数据从Teradata导出到中间存储,并将数据加载到Oracle数据库中。 4. 验证和调优:验证数据在Oracle中的完整性和准确性,并进行性能调优,以确保迁移后的数据满足业务需求。 5. 更改应用连接:更新现有应用程序的连接字符串,以便将查询和事务路由到Oracle数据库。

teradata数据迁移到 oracle1

技术人员要求: - 熟悉Teradata和Oracle数据库的系统管理员和数据库管理员。 - 熟悉数据迁移工具和ETL工具的数据工程师。 - 有SQL编程和数据转换经验的开发人员。

注意事项: - 提前备份数据:在进行数据迁移之前,务必对Teradata和Oracle数据库进行数据备份,以防数据丢失或损坏。 - 迁移计划:制定详细的迁移计划,包括时间安排、资源分配和风险评估。 - 数据一致性:确保迁移后的数据在结构和内容上与原始数据一致。 - 和验证:对迁移后的数据进行全面的和验证,以确保数据质量和准确性。

容易出错的地方和解决方案: - 数据类型转换错误:在进行数据清洗和转换时,可能会出现数据类型转换错误。在数据迁移之前,仔细检查源数据类型,并确保目标数据类型与之匹配。 - 数据丢失:在迁移过程中可能会出现数据丢失。为了减少数据丢失的风险,建议在迁移之前进行备份,并进行数据验证和比对。 - 性能问题:在迁移大量数据时,可能会遇到性能问题。通过对数据库进行性能调优、优化SQL查询、增加硬件资源等方法,可以解决性能问题。

相关FAQ: 1. 是否可以在迁移过程中进行增量数据迁移?是的,可以使用Oracle GoldenGate等工具进行增量数据迁移。 2. 是否可以在迁移过程中进行数据转换?是的,可以在ETL工具中进行数据转换,包括数据类型转换、日期格式转换等。 3. 是否可以将Teradata中的所有功能迁移到Oracle中?不是所有功能都可以完全迁移到Oracle中,可能需要进行某些功能的重新设计和实现。

欢迎先咨询资深专业技术数据恢复和系统修复专家为您解决问题
电话 : 13438888961   微信: 联系工程师

oracle 数据库全表迁移

Oracle数据库全表迁移场景可以包括Oracle数据库版本升级、数据中心搬迁、迁移数据到新系统等。下面将分别从适用场景、原因、解决方案、处理流程、技术人员要求、注意事项、容易出错的地方以及方案以及相

oracle 数据迁移服务器

Oracle数据迁移服务器的实际应用场景 适用场景: Oracle数据库迁移到新的服务器是企业中常见的任务之一。以下是一些适用场景的示例: 1. 服务器升级:企业可能需要将其Oracle数据库从旧的服

oracle 数据 冷迁移dd

Oracle 数据冷迁移是指将存储在Oracle数据库中的数据转移到其他地方(比如另一个数据库或存储系统)。这种迁移方式常用于备份数据、数据归档、数据整理以及遵循法律要求。 适用场景: 1. 数据库升

oracle 数据文件迁移

如何进行Oracle数据文件迁移 适用场景: 在Oracle数据库中,数据文件是存储数据的重要组成部分。当需要更改数据库存储位置、进行数据库迁移或数据库空间不足时,需要进行数据文件的迁移。以下是一个详

oracle 表数据迁移到另一个表sql

将Oracle表数据迁移到SQL Server 2000是在某些情况下需要进行的操作。下面我们将探讨适用场景、原因和解决方案,以及一些案例解析来说明这一过程。 适用场景: 1. 公司或组织要从Orac

软阵列 raid1故障转错

RAID 1是一种数据存储方案,它使用两个磁盘驱动器将数据复制到两个不同的磁盘上。如果其中一个磁盘发生故障,另一个磁盘将继续提供存储和访问数据的功能。 当RAID 1中的一个磁盘发生故障时,故障转错的

磁盘阵列硬盘故障现象

磁盘阵列是通过组合多个硬盘来提供数据存储和冗余备份的技术。当其中一个硬盘发生故障时,磁盘阵列会出现以下可能的故障现象: 1. 容量减小:由于其中一个硬盘停止工作,磁盘阵列的总容量会减少。这是因为磁盘阵

oracle 数据迁移到tidb

在大数据时代,数据迁移成为了许多企业不可忽视的需求。尤其对于一些传统的关系型数据库,如Oracle,随着数据量的不断增长,性能问题逐渐暴露。一种常见的解决方案是将Oracle数据迁移到分布式数据库中,

硬盘阵列盒断电会怎么样

当硬盘阵列盒断电时,可能会发生以下情况: 1. 数据丢失:如果硬盘阵列盒断电时正在进行写操作,那么可能会导致数据丢失。写操作通常需要一定时间来将数据保存到硬盘上,如果断电时尚未完成,那么这些数据可能会

oracle 重装数据迁移

Oracle数据库重装数据迁移的应用场景、原因和解决方案 Oracle数据库是企业级数据库系统中常用的一款产品,但在一些特定情况下,用户可能需要进行数据库重装和数据迁移操作。本文将围绕这个话题展开讨论